These are different time periods you might use to create a personal budget.

What is daily, weekly, bi weekly, monthly, and/or annually?

200

These are names of credit bureaus

What are Experian, Equifax or TransUnion?

Name a type of expense that refers to either it being the same every month or fluctuating each month.

What is fixed, flexible, and discretionary?

400

This is the range of FICO credit scores.

What is 300-850?

400

If you had to choose between receiving $1,000 every day for 30 days, OR a penny that doubles each day for 30 days, this option will pay you the most money

Penny. ($1,000 x 30 days = $30,000 or ((2^30) – 1 = 1,073,741,823 / 100 = $10,737,418.23)
